The flame sensor is a single metal rod that sits directly in the burner flame and confirms — through flame rectification — that the burners actually lit after the igniter fired. The control board reads a tiny microamp current passing through the flame. When the rod oxidizes or its porcelain insulator cracks, the board can no longer 'see' the flame and shuts the gas valve within seconds as a safety. The classic symptom is burners that light for 3-7 seconds and then go out, with the furnace short-cycling — light, drop, retry, lockout — leaving the home with little or no heat. Specs: This is a flame-rectification rod, not a thermocouple. A clean sensor in a healthy flame should pass roughly 1-6 microamps DC (measured in series with a meter set to µA); below about 0.5-1 µA the board will drop the flame and close the gas valve. The rod mounts with a single screw and carries a low-voltage signal lead back to the control board. OEM vs Generic: Although inexpensive, a flame sensor must have the correct rod length, alloy, and porcelain insulator so it sits properly in the flame and resists oxidation. Generic rods built with thinner wire or poorly fired ceramic foul and crack faster, returning you to short-cycling within a single season.
